Quahogs are the classic here in Boston - they're big and not good for much use other than chowder - and they're usually inexpensive. But I actually prefer either littlenecks or cherrystones, since they tend to be more tender. Oh, and I should have added, don't get too strong a bacon - this is actually a case where a good store bought bacon works just fine, since you don't want the bacon to overpower the clams, just add a hint of smokiness.
